Most people think roof damage starts with a storm.
In Arizona, it usually starts months before the storm ever arrives.
Extreme heat, intense UV exposure, and daily temperature swings slowly wear down roofing materials, break down sealants, and create weak spots that homeowners often can't see.
Then monsoon season hits.
Heavy rain, high winds, and flying debris can expose damage that has been developing all year long.
That's why Arizona roofing is different. It takes the right materials, proper installation, and a contractor who understands what Valley roofs face every season.
